Frequently asked questions

How is Asahi Kasei structured as an investment entity?

Asahi Kasei is not a fund or family office. It operates as a publicly listed Japanese corporation with three industrial divisions — Healthcare, Homes, and Material. The firm directly develops and commercializes products rather than making third-party fund commitments or co-investments. Its investor-relations page and medium-term management plan reflect a public-company governance model.

What does Asahi Kasei’s Healthcare segment actually do?

The Healthcare segment focuses on pharmaceuticals and medical devices addressing unmet medical needs, under the mission 'Improve and save patients' lives.' The firm's website presents this as a core business line rather than a venture-investing arm. Specific drug or device programs are not detailed on the main corporate site.

Does Asahi Kasei deploy capital into external funds or startups?

Current public disclosures show no venture-capital or fund-commitment activity. The firm operates as a direct industrial company, allocating capital internally to its three business sectors. Any venture or external investment activity would appear in the IR Library or medium-term plan, but neither source is known to list such programs.

Who makes investment and capital-allocation decisions at Asahi Kasei?

Capital allocation is governed by the corporation's President and board, consistent with Japanese public-company governance. The website features a Message from the President and a medium-term management plan outlining strategic direction. No single CIO or family principal is identified as the decision-maker.

Where does Asahi Kasei operate geographically?

Corporate headquarters are in Tokyo, Japan, and the firm lists an office in Toronto, Canada. The three business sectors serve primarily domestic markets, though the Toronto presence and the Materials segment's global chemical markets suggest some international reach. The website does not break down revenue by region.
